The full line-up for Pro Wrestling NOAH's 4th annual NTV Cup - Jr. Heavyweight Tag League;

Block A

KENTA & Atsushi Aoki
Taiji Ishimori & Ricky Marvin
Katsuhiko Nakajima & Satoshi Kajiwara (representing Kensuke Office)
Great Sasuke & Kenbai (representing Michinoku Pro)
Roderick Strong & Eddie Edwards (representing Ring of Honor)

Block B

Yoshinobu Kanemaru & Genba Hirayanagi
Yoshinari Ogawa & Kotaro Suzuki
Dick Togo & Yasu Urano (representing DDT)
Atsushi Kotoge & Daisuke Harada (representing Osaka Pro)
Jack Evans & Extreme Tiger (representing AAA)

The tournament will run on NOAH's Autumn Navigation tour from the 15th to 30th of October.
